Feng Ling is the kitchen god of Luer Village, but today he always feels a little uncomfortable.

As the Kitchen God, his duties are much easier than those of the Land God. He does not need to be in charge of the land book and various affairs with the underworld like the Land God. He only needs to stay quietly in his kitchen altar, record the good and evil deeds of the mortals in the area under his jurisdiction, and make a report to heaven at the end of the year.

Therefore, it is basically difficult to see the Kitchen God outside, because they spend most of their time staying in their own kitchen altar to monitor good and evil, or to meditate and practice.

He always felt that there seemed to be something abnormal in Luer Village outside, but he couldn't figure out what was abnormal.

After thinking about it, Feng Ling stood up and walked out of the temple. The moment he walked out of the temple, Feng Ling realized that something was wrong. There was clearly a trace of the aura of the Immortal Official Jade Disc in Luer Village.

Moreover, he could feel that the owner of this Immortal Official Jade Disc seemed to be of a much higher rank than himself, because the aura of this Immortal Official Jade Disc was vague and elusive. If it weren't for his usually sensitive soul, he wouldn't have been able to detect it at all.

After Feng Ling flew out of the monastery, he immediately followed the energy and came to a simple earthen house. He looked into the house in confusion, and then cast a spell. A fairy light flashed on his body, and he immediately flew into the kitchen stove shrine in the earthen house.

As long as there is a kitchen stove at home, the Kitchen God can fly in directly using his unique magic.

After flying into the stove shrine in Mei Xianzhang's kitchen, the Kitchen God walked out directly from the shrine. However, just as he came out, he heard a calm and clear voice from the front: "Master Kitchen, you are here."

Feng Ling looked up and immediately saw Fang Jian, who was wearing a light blue Taoist robe. He was slightly startled and quickly stepped forward to pay his respects, saying, "I am Feng Ling, the Kitchen God of Luer Village. I pay my respects to the Lord God."

Fang Jian raised his hand and said, "No need to be polite, Kitchen God. I am Fang Jian, and my Taoist name is Hong Qing."

"Master Hongqing!" Feng Ling was shocked. "What brings you to Luer Village? I apologize for not welcoming you in person."

Fang Jian waved his hand and said, "I don't do these empty rituals here. In fact, I deliberately leaked a trace of the energy of the Immortal Official Jade Disc to lure the Kitchen God here."

"Oh?" Upon hearing this, the Kitchen God bowed and said, "I wonder what instructions Master Hongqing has for you?"

"Just give me orders..." Fang Jian smiled, then pointed at the mud house under his feet and said, "Do you know the little girl who lives here?"

"Master Hongqing, are you talking about Mei Qing's daughter, Mei Xianzhang, who is only seven years old now?" Feng Ling asked.

Fang Jian nodded and said, "Yes, she and I have a master-disciple relationship. We just performed the apprenticeship ceremony yesterday."

"Ah?" Feng Ling was startled, then said, "So this poor child is actually the destined disciple of Master Hongqing."

Fang Jian smiled and said, "It's just that she hasn't started practicing yet and hasn't practiced fasting yet, so she still needs to eat grains from the human world..."

Feng Ling understood immediately and said to Fang Jian, "Master Hongqing, don't worry. From now on, the food Xiao Xianzhang cooks will definitely be the best in Bailu City. There won't be any impurities in her food."

"Then I'll have to trouble the Kitchen God." Fang Jian bowed.

Feng Ling shook his head and said, "Master Hongqing, you are too polite. As the Kitchen God, this is all I can do for you."

"That's enough." Fang Jian said with a smile.

The Kitchen God does not actually have much power on earth. His power is mainly concentrated in monitoring the good and evil in the world, and then going directly to heaven to report to the Great Heavenly Venerable and the other great emperors at the end of the year.

As for the Kitchen God's authority in the human world, it is to reward or punish people based on the word "stove".

If you are a very evil person, the Kitchen God can guarantee that the food you cook will be raw eight out of ten times and half-cooked two out of ten times.

If you are neither extremely good nor extremely evil, and are just an ordinary mortal, then the Kitchen God will not pay any attention to you. Whether the food in your home is raw or cooked, delicious or unpalatable, all depends on the cooking skills of the cook.

As for those who are very kind, the Kitchen God will naturally bless your family with sweet and delicious meals, and ensure that they are healthy and safe!

"I'll live here from now on." Feng Ling said directly to Fang Jian.

Fang Jian smiled faintly. Which stove the Kitchen God lives in is his own business.

Soon, Feng Ling flew into the kitchen of Mei Xianzhang's house, and Fang Jian also walked out of the kitchen.

Mei Xianzhang was writing on the floor of the main hall with charcoal. Fang Jian walked over to take a look and asked, "What are you writing?"

"It was you, Dad, who taught me the word 'Mei'." Mei Xianzhang said.

Ever since Mei Xianzhang called him "Dad" yesterday, no matter how Fang Jian tried to correct her, she just kept calling him that more and more often, and finally she simply stopped changing.

Fang Jian was also helpless about this. After he went to heaven, he would have to explain to everyone why he had a daughter. However, although they were called daughters, they were actually master and disciple.

"Oh..." Fang Jian looked at the crooked word "梅". He couldn't make out what it was anyway.

Mei Xianzhang wrote intently for the time it took him to write an incense stick, until the entire floor of the main hall was covered with the crooked "Mei" character. Finally, he heaved a long, tired sigh before standing up. "Dad, where is your home?"

Fang Jian smiled and said, "I have a home up there, and another home in the north. You'll find out later."

"Up...to the north..." Mei Xianzhang thought for a moment, then said, "Isn't Luer Mountain to the north?"

In Mei Xianzhang's impression, the northernmost place is Luer Mountain. Just like what the old people in the village say to their children, children do not have a grand concept of geography. What they see is the limit of their imagination of the real world.
